A block of mass kg 5 is moving horizontally at a speed of `1.5 m//s` . A perpendicular force of 5 N acts on it for 4 sec. What will be the distance of the block from the point where the force started acting

A

10 m

B

8m

C

6 m

D

2 m

Text Solution

Verified by Experts

The correct Answer is:
A

m = 5kg : u = 1.5 m/s (horizontal )
`a = (5)/(5) = 1 m//s^(2) ` (perpendicular to velocity)
`S_(H) = ut = 1.5 xx 4 =6 m`
`S_(V)= (1)/(2) at^(2) = (1)/(2) xx 1 xx (4)^(2) = 8m`
`S_("net") = sqrt(6^(2) + 8^(2)) = 10m`
